If you want to make your home more welcoming, then you should ensure you clear out the entryway and porch and hang a beautiful wreath with twinkly lights. It is also advisable for you to focus your creativity efforts on the tree and choose a color palette that is going to complement the tone of your house. You can also make your house holiday ready by looking to the mantelpiece as you think about that the dcor. When you have artificial green garlands coordinating with your dcor, this is going to make your mantelpiece look beautiful.
It is important to plan for food ahead which may entail you asking everyone to bring with them a dish for a night before Christmas buffet. This is going to help you save time and money. It is advisable to use the leftover matching Christmas decorations to dress your table and supplement it with a centerpiece for your meal that will look bold. You can also make your house holiday ready by having drinks that you will toast to the meal and also upgrade your champagne flutes and drinking glasses.
Another way to make your house holiday ready is by ensuring that you refresh your guestroom with themed linens, a Christmas tree and towels. You can also make your house holiday ready by having a freshly hung towel that people will use to dry their hands and a basket of bathroom goodies.
